Kempf-Leonard, Duncan, Mardis, Christie-David named to key positions
The Board of Trustees on Thursday approved the appointment of Kimberly Kempf-Leonard as dean of the College of Arts and Sciences. Kempf-Leonard comes to UofL from Southern Illinois University, where she has served as dean of the College of Liberal Arts. She will assume the new post on Aug. 1.
Darrell A. Griffith named associate vice president for health affairs at UofL
Darrell A. Griffith has been named the new associate vice president for health affairs/finance and administration for the University of Louisville Health Sciences Center. He also will assume the position of vice president/CFO for University of Louisville Physicians. Griffith comes from the University of Kentucky/UK Healthcare, where he was the executive director for the faculty practice organization.
